Output 28a01a73e5135773064e2d5ef897a964c3e49af367f8862d81f28c49a65b88cf:19

value
3784228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77fcc976f3b5eb9abcc741896d3ef3c668f20c9f OP_EQUAL
address
3CdTAKQsUDY5Ggfm5RsxMkLVuNRsBqqt8G
transaction
28a01a73e5135773064e2d5ef897a964c3e49af367f8862d81f28c49a65b88cf
confirmations
382335
spent
true